A cursive, hand-drawn script with a pronounced forward slant and a brush-pen feel. Strokes show strong thick–thin modulation, with rounded terminals, tapered entries, and occasional teardrop-like endings. Letterforms are narrow and upright in their internal structure but animated by springy curves, tall ascenders, and long, sweeping descenders; spacing is slightly irregular in a natural handwritten way. The set mixes connected writing with selective breaks between letters, keeping a flowing rhythm without strict continuous joining.

Well-suited to short-to-medium phrases where an informal, handcrafted tone is desired, such as boutique branding, packaging labels, greeting cards, invitations, posters, and quote graphics for social content. It works especially well at larger sizes where the contrast and looping details can remain clear.

The overall tone is upbeat and personable, reading like quick, confident handwriting with a bit of flair. Its looping forms and lively contrast give it a charming, slightly whimsical voice that feels informal and human rather than polished or corporate.

The design appears intended to mimic brushy cursive handwriting with expressive contrast and a light, bouncy rhythm, offering a friendly signature-like voice for display typography. Its narrow, flowing forms prioritize personality and motion over strict uniformity, aiming for an approachable handmade impression.

Capitals tend to be tall and gestural, functioning like small display initials, while lowercase forms keep a consistent cursive cadence. Round letters (o, e, a) are open and fluid, and the numerals are similarly handwritten with simple, airy shapes that match the stroke behavior of the letters.
